Suggest Remedy For Swelling And Redness In The Toe Nail Bed

My toenail hasnt grown and the toe nail bed is swollen and red. Not that much pus has came out just very little. It has gotten a little better since I started soaking it in warm water and epson salt 3 times daily. If I continue this would it get better on its own?

Dermatologist 's  Response
hi there.
1. your concern may be paronychia by your description.
2. its a bacterial infection of nail bed.
3. don't pick it up for preventing secondary infection.
4. you require oral full course of antibiotics for controlling the pus.
this is not serious but don't neglect,consult a dermatologist near by you for starting oral antibiotics.
this will help you don't worry, until then start using tbact ointment on the affected nail.
